    Ok I have email scanning turned on.

    I have it turned on in both scanning pop3/s port as well as the other options that can be set in outlook.

    Recently I had a weird problem where a friend reinstalled his email server and since then nod32 can not talk to it over ssl so I disabled nod32 pop3s scanning.

    I noticed however I am still seeing emails scanned.

    Is it now scanning email's when I click on them? (I notice a delay now)
    Is it less secure scanning email's on demand after they downloaded than over the ports?
    When I scan over the port's does it stop it scanning a 2nd time inside outlook after download?
